A gorgeous edition of one of the most beloved classics of the twentieth century, published in celebration of W. W. Nortons 100th anniversary.This slim volume of letters from the poet and mystic, Rainer Maria Rilke, to a nineteenyearold cadet and aspiring poet named Franz Xaver Kappus, has touched millions of readers since it was first published in English in 1934. The translator, Mary Dows Herter Nortona polymath extraordinaire with expertise in music, literature, and science, and who, along with her husband, William Warder Norton, founded the company that bears his nameplayed a crucial role in elevating Rilkes reputation in the Englishspeaking world.This Norton Centenary Edition commemorates Norton, known as Polly to friends and colleagues, and the 100th anniversary of the publishing company she cofounded. An admiring foreword by Damion Searlshimself a recent translator of Rilkes Letterscelebrates Pollys stylistic achievement, and an afterword by Nortons President, Julia A. Reidhead, honors her commitment to maintaining W. W. Norton & Companys independence.This handsome new edition of a beloved classic brings Rilkes enduring wisdom about life, love, and art to a new generation, in the translation that first introduced him to the Englishspeaking world. 2 illustrations
